iPhone 17 Air could feature high-density battery cells

digitaltrends.com

Apple's upcoming iPhone 17 Air may feature high-density battery cells to improve battery life despite its slim design. The device is expected to be just 5.5mm thick with a large 6.7-inch screen. Industry analyst Ming-Chi Kuo noted that this will be the first iPhone to use high-density battery technology, allowing for more energy storage in a compact space. Additional features, like a power-efficient modem and more internal space from removing the Ultra Wide camera, may also enhance battery performance. The iPhone 17 Air is set to be unveiled in September 2025.
